Fertilizing is fundamental to supporting plant health and accomplishing lavish, vibrant landscapes. Plants require a bal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and keep lively foliage. A soil test is the primary step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the chosen fertilizer meets the particular requirements of the site. Fertilizers can be found in numerous kinds, including granular, liquid, organic, and synthetic, each providing different release rates and advantages. Using the best type at the correct time is necessary to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or irregular growth.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ants get ready for growth spurts or endure winter season tension. Constant fertilization not only improves plant appearance but also enhances resilience against pests, illness, and ecological stress factors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to flourish every year, providing both beauty and eco-friendly value
